The turtle shell, so exquisitely formed, is emblematic of Mother Earth. Many Native Americans revere turtles and some refer to North America as Turtle Island. This version of our Turtle Shell Pendant is made from vibrant 18kt gold and sterling silver; the underside of the shell is a reflector bowl, magnifying the beauty of a prong set natural domestic turquoise 7 cts. Feng Shui For Real Life
Feng Shui (pronounced "fung shway") is a design system for arranging your surroundings in harmony and balance with the natural world around you.
